(Cornell Multi-grid Coupled Tsunami Model) is one of the most widely recognized open-source numerical simulation tools for modeling the complete life cycle of a tsunami—from generation to propagation and inundation. Version 1.7 represents a stable, mature iteration of this Fortran-based code, widely used by researchers and hazard assessment agencies.
